Output e3d6d64f39ffd9be1c67a495987d843fd6cff756d138e7b99241881e0c95dfa3:32

value
18284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e15170afc5480ad1f7dcd8853e6ff8e2f0d95767 OP_EQUAL
address
3NEPXGXz8XbYgRs4P4yGNgGQM5xJdiL18N
transaction
e3d6d64f39ffd9be1c67a495987d843fd6cff756d138e7b99241881e0c95dfa3
spent
true